Synthesis of Fluorine Substituted Silicon-Nitrogen Compounds
Hensen, Karl,Pickel, Peter
, p. 223 - 228 (2007/10/02)
Chlorine and bromine substituted silicon nitrogen compounds react in acetonitrile with lithium fluoride to yield the fluorine substituted silicon nitrogen compounds.This reaction, which takes place under moderate conditions, is characterised by high yields.In contrast to other fluorinating agents fission of the silicon nitrogen bond does not occur.The fluorine substituted aminosilanes 1-4 and diaminosilanes 5,6 are synthezised by chlorine/fluorine exchange. 1 is also obtained by bromine/fluorine exchange.
